Can Tableau map 3 digit ZIP?
Tableau only supports 5 digit zip codes in the US so you may struggle with 3 digits…. Also, you could add longitude/ latitude instead of zip code.
Does Tableau recognize zip codes?
When geocoding, Tableau Desktop only recognizes five-digit ZIP codes.
How do I use zip codes in tableau?
To create a map, please use the steps below:
- Double-click the Postal Code dimension from the Data window to create the map.
- On the Marks Card, from the drop-down list of views, select Map.
- Drag Profit to Color on the Marks card.
- Format color and font as desired.

What locations does Tableau recognize?
Tableau supports worldwide airport codes, cities, countries, regions, territories, states, provinces, and some postcodes and second-level administrative districts (county-equivalents).
Can Tableau recognize street addresses?
We all know that we can create some pretty cool maps in Tableau using fields like City, State and ZIP Code; however, Tableau cannot natively map street addresses. In order to plot specific addresses, we’ll need to use latitude and longitude coordinates.
